New member here. I especially enjoy photographing the beautiful birds that grace the Central Coast of California. I prefer portrait style captures whenever possible and use superzoom cameras to accomplish this. All of my bird and wildlife photographs were taken hand-held and have not been cropped.

I especially enjoy taking advantage of side-lighting to capture the types of images I find appealing, so shooting during early morning or late afternoon works best for me. I use Photoshop Elements 12 and Topaz Labs DeNoise to post-process my images.

Love the dark backgrounds. I'm guessing that you're using a flash for this?

Light Catcher
10-06-2016, 10:44 PM
Well done.
Love the dark backgrounds. I'm guessing that you're using a flash for this?

Thanks.

I don't use a flash for my black background photos. I think the best and most complete way to share this information with you is to include this excerpt from my "Canon SX50 Hints & Tips" page from my photography website. Fortunately, many people like this effect and I always enjoy sharing information regarding camera technique & strategies. Let me know if you have any further questions.

Here's the excerpt:

MY BLACK BACKGROUND PHOTOS
My favorite type of image involves the use of "side-lighting" of the subject. During early morning or late afternoon hours I simply take advantage of the position of the sun. I place myself in a position so the sunlight is mainly striking the subject from the side. In this way, the subject is typically half in sunlight and half in shadow. Think of a first quarter or gibbous moon, for example. Additionally, the black backgrounds you see in my images require that the area especially behind the subject be fairly dark to begin with. I start decreasing the Exposure Compensation value until the foreground and background begin to "disappear." In this way, plenty of sunlight remains on the subject and areas around it begin to darken. I make adjustments until I like what I see. Now I have a good "foundation" image to work with during post-processing. I use Photoshop Elements 12. During post-processing I first select a one-click AUTO LEVELS or AUTO CONTRAST depending on which looks best. Then under "ADJUST LIGHTING" I simply decrease the LEVELS until all hints of the information around the subject goes completely black. The subject still remains in "good light" while everything else in the frame is now black and I'm left with the images you see on my website. That's it.
